**Company Description** “We’re not in the shipping business; we’re in the information business” -Peter Rose, Expeditors Founder Global supply chain management is what we do, but at the heart of Expeditors you will find professionalism, leadership, and a friendly environment, all of which foster an innovative, customer service-based approach to logistics. Organic Growth - Expeditors promotes from within. As a shining example, our CEO started as an entry level employee in our San Francisco office 31 years ago. - 15,000 trained professionals - 250+ locations worldwide - Fortune 500 - Globally unified systems Job standards - Working within the guidelines outlined in the Expeditors culture and mission statement. - Keeping the work area in an organized and tidy manner. - Utilize computers and equipment for company business only. - Dress according to company policy. - Portraying a professional attitude at all times and a willingness to work as a team member. - Sick days and appointments: As per Expeditors Policy. Job responsibilities - Complete all work within the guidelines and Air Lateral/OPS requirements. - First priority of this job function is the handling and expediting of "live shipments" - Tracing and tracking of inbound freight from overseas pre-alerts to tracing with the airlines - Clerical responsibilities: logging pre-alerts, entering client numbers and making folders, filing - Enter event codes as trained and outlined in the Air Lateral/OPS manual. - Follow customer SOP. - Communications: - Overseas (origin) must be kept up-to-date on the status of shipments - Pickup phone calls within the department. - Scan all documents into the system as required. - It is the Air Import Agent's responsibility to advise and discuss with the supervisor if any part of the above responsibilities cannot be completed. Report Function Responsibilities - Daily review of the Breakbulk and Electronically Logged Reports - If for any reason, whatsoever, this cannot be done as stipulated above, the import agent is to notify their supervisor immediately as this will affect the weekly Air Lateral quality results. Accounting - Closing and settling shipments according to Air Lateral/OPS manual - Bill customer timely according to Air Lateral/OPS manual - Correct EDI and billing errors based on daily/monthly reporting tools provided. **Qualifications** - University Degree or Industry Specific Diploma - 1-2 years of experience in the industry is ideal - Computer savvy - Customer service experience is a plus **Additional Information** - Paid Vacation, Holiday, Sick Time - Health Plan: Medical, Prescription Drug, Dental and Vision - Life and Long Term Disability Insurance - RRSP Retirement Savings Plan - Employee Stock Purchase Plan - Training and Personnel Development Program Annual compensation is from CAD 45,000 to 52,000.
